Repairing accidents, tears and wounds allows us to follow the Japanese philosophy of \"wabi-sabi,\" or finding solace in what is perfectly imperfect. Reinforcing and stitching a hole can make it stronger while leaving behind an artifact of the effort that was made to maintain something beloved. \u003cem\u003eCreating a hole\u003c\/em\u003e can also allow us to be innovative and play with compelling new dimensions and ways of thinking. \u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cspan\u003e\u003cspan style=\"font-family: arial, sans-serif;\"\u003eFor our morning session, we will begin by learning the Japanese art of Sashiko or \"tiny stabs\" and make a custom patch using indigo dyed fabric and cotton thread. Students will learn a brief history of the art form and the meaning behind different pattern stitch designs, as well as helpful techniques to extend the life of your own wardrobe through visible mending.
